Medical examination of third-country nationals subject to a visa regime before the extension of their residence permit is prescribed by the Ordinance on the Residence of Third-Country Nationals in the Republic of Croatia, while the content of the examination is defined by the Decision of the Minister of Health, based on the Act on the Protection of the Population from Infectious Diseases.
The mandatory medical examination includes the collection of information on the person’s health status through an interview and review of medical documentation, a physical examination, a chest X-ray, stool testing for infectious disease pathogens, and blood tests for the presence of certain infections.
The examinations are carried out at public health institutes. Persons subject to the examination (workers with a temporary residence permit) should, with a referral issued by their employer, report for the examination at the territorially competent public health institute according to their place of residence.
The employer issues the worker a referral form, and arranges an appointment for the worker with the competent public health institute by telephone or email.
The costs of the examination are covered by the employer based on the invoice issued by the public health institute after the foreign worker attends the examination.
The basic examination includes a physical examination, chest X-ray and interpretation of the X-ray image, stool testing for Salmonella typhi/paratyphi, blood sampling for testing for markers of blood-borne infectious diseases, and catch-up vaccination if required. If a person has results from previous examinations (e.g. chest X-ray images), they should bring them with them in order to avoid repeating tests if they have been performed recently.
Within a few days after attending the examination, based on the test results, the person receives a Certificate of Completed Medical Examination, including recommendations for further medical evaluation if necessary and a catch-up vaccination plan if required.
